PC-Teijin Panlite L-1250Y

PC-Teijin Panlite L-1250Y is a medium-viscosity, general-purpose polycarbonate resin developed by Teijin, formulated with integrated easy-release additives for high-yield precision molding. Featuring a melt volume-flow rate (MVR) of 8.0 cm³/10 min (at 300°C/1.2kg) and an ISO Charpy notched impact strength of 76 kJ/m², this grade offers a high refractive index of 1.585 and 88% light transmittance. PC-Teijin Panlite L-1250Y Tooling & Optical Defect Mitigation Guide

Molding an optical-grade, medium-viscosity resin like Panlite L-1250Y requires precise mold temperature control and zero-moisture drying to protect optical clarity:

  • Pristine Optical Polishing (S136 steel): Microscopic tool marks on core or cavity surfaces will scatter light, causing optical haze. Jucheng’s tooling division uses premium S136 stainless steel mold cavity inserts, mirror-polished to a high level, ensuring parts emerge with flawless, glass-like clarity.
  • Desiccant Drying & Splay Prevention: Wet PC is highly susceptible to hydrolytic polymer chain fracture, destroying mechanical strength and causing splay or silver streaks. We dry raw resin in desiccant hopper dryers at 120°C (248°F) for 3–4 hours, keeping moisture strictly below 0.02%.
  • Low Internal Stress (Molding Temperatures): Processing barrel temperatures are maintained between 280°C and 320°C (536°F to 608°F). Mold temperatures are kept at 80°C to 110°C (176°F to 230°F) to ensure maximum gloss and reduce residual internal molding stresses.
  • Shrinkage & Warpage: Panlite L-1250Y exhibits low and highly uniform shrinkage (0.5% to 0.7%). We machine balanced, conformal cooling circuits directly into core blocks to speed up heat dissipation, further reducing cycle times and preventing thermal warpage.

Properties

Density 1.2 g/cm³
Melt Volume-Flow Rate (MVR) (300°C/1.2kg) 8 cm³/10min
Light Transmittance (3.0 mm) 88 %
Refractive Index 1.585 -
Tensile Modulus 2,400 MPa
Tensile Yield Stress 61 MPa
Tensile Yield Strain 6 %
Flexural Modulus 2300 MPa
Flexural Strength 91 MPa
Charpy Notched Impact Strength (23°C) 76 kJ/m²
Rockwell Hardness (M-Scale) 77 -
Vicat Softening Point 149 °C
Heat Deflection Temperature (HDT @ 0.45 MPa) 142 °C
Heat Deflection Temperature (HDT @ 1.80 MPa) 129 °C
Linear Mold Shrinkage 0.50 - 0.70 %
Flammability Rating (1.5mm) UL 94 HB -
